SEVERAL casualties are feared following a helicopter crash in a remote Irish town as emergency services respond to the scene this evening.

The incident took place in Joristown, Killucan, Co Westmeath at around 3.30pm.

Acting Chief Fire Officer with Westmeath Fire and Rescue Service Pat Hunt told Midlands 103 FM that every available resource is being diverted to the scene.

He added: “Mullingar Fire Brigade and all the units in the station have been mobilised to the scene.

“We understand that it’s an incident involving an aircraft, a helicopter, crashing into a building in the Joristown upper townland in Killucan, Co Westmeath.

“At the moment it’s a breaking news story, we have all the principal response agencies mobilising to the scene, that would be An Garda Siochana, the ambulance services and ourselves.

“What we can understand is that there are a number of casualties involved but again we can’t at this stage confirm the number.”

Gardai said in a short statement: “Gardai and emergency services are currently at the scene of an incident involving a helicopter at a location near Killucan, Co Westmeath which occurred at approximately 3.30pm.

“As this is a live and ongoing operation, no further information is available at this time.”

Mayor of Mullingar-Kinnegad Municipal District Ken Glynn said it was a “shocking and tragic” incident.

He said his thoughts and prayers were with the families of those involved and the emergency services who first responded to the scene.

He told RTE: “I’m surprised and shocked, it’s not something you would expect to hear in your own locality.

“It is a difficult scene for emergency services to be attending.”

The Air Accident Investigation Unit said it had been notified and was sending out a team of inspectors to the scene.

It added in a statement: “The AAIU has been notified of an accident involving a single-engine helicopter near Killucan Co. Westmeath this afternoon.

“The AAIU is deploying a team of inspectors at this time.

“Further updates will be provided when available.”

Sinn Fein TD for Longford-Westmeath Sorca Clarke said: “I’m devastated for the people involved, it’s absolutely horrendous.

“It’s terrible news to be hearing. I’m so sorry to hear what’s after happening.”
